Project

General

Profile

Bug #4521

Updated by Mark Clarkstone over 7 years ago

Running tvheadend git on my BPi M1 (Allwinner A20 / 1GB ram) & streaming a service to VLC and got this 

 <pre> ``` 
 [251815.850759] tvheadend invoked oom-killer: gfp_mask=0x14201ca(GFP_HIGHUSER_MOVABLE|__GFP_COLD), nodemask=(null),    order=0, oom_score_adj=0 
 [251815.850779] tvheadend cpuset=/ mems_allowed=0 
 [251815.850800] CPU: 0 PID: 738 Comm: tvheadend Not tainted 4.12.4-sunxi #1 
 [251815.850804] Hardware name: Allwinner sun7i (A20) Family 
 [251815.850837] [<c010cb5d>] (unwind_backtrace) from [<c0109889>] (show_stack+0x11/0x14) 
 [251815.850853] [<c0109889>] (show_stack) from [<c051aa2d>] (dump_stack+0x69/0x78) 
 [251815.850870] [<c051aa2d>] (dump_stack) from [<c0210689>] (dump_header+0x79/0x18e) 
 [251815.850884] [<c0210689>] (dump_header) from [<c01c9e25>] (oom_kill_process+0x259/0x3d8) 
 [251815.850895] [<c01c9e25>] (oom_kill_process) from [<c01ca28d>] (out_of_memory+0x169/0x21c) 
 [251815.850908] [<c01ca28d>] (out_of_memory) from [<c01cdd0f>] (__alloc_pages_nodemask+0xa87/0xb4c) 
 [251815.850922] [<c01cdd0f>] (__alloc_pages_nodemask) from [<c01c8735>] (filemap_fault+0x251/0x4a0) 
 [251815.850935] [<c01c8735>] (filemap_fault) from [<c028b3bb>] (ext4_filemap_fault+0x1f/0x2c) 
 [251815.850950] [<c028b3bb>] (ext4_filemap_fault) from [<c01e9c9b>] (__do_fault+0x13/0x44) 
 [251815.850962] [<c01e9c9b>] (__do_fault) from [<c01ecc27>] (handle_mm_fault+0x38b/0x8a0) 
 [251815.850974] [<c01ecc27>] (handle_mm_fault) from [<c0112ae1>] (do_page_fault+0xd9/0x234) 
 [251815.850986] [<c0112ae1>] (do_page_fault) from [<c01012a9>] (do_PrefetchAbort+0x2d/0x70) 
 [251815.850996] [<c01012a9>] (do_PrefetchAbort) from [<c010a73b>] (__pabt_usr+0x5b/0x5c) 
 [251815.851001] Exception stack(0xc9fbffb0 to 0xc9fbfff8) 
 [251815.851008] ffa0:                                       0003d090 00000000 0003d090 00000000 
 [251815.851017] ffc0: 00ecbf10 00000000 00000000 006bd638 00002710 00000000 b48ff3a4 bef8c430 
 [251815.851025] ffe0: 00704660 b48feb38 005e9603 b6b1ee04 00030030 ffffffff 
 [251815.851029] Mem-Info: 
 [251815.851046] active_anon:119960 inactive_anon:119995 isolated_anon:0 
  active_file:88 inactive_file:112 isolated_file:0 
  unevictable:0 dirty:0 writeback:0 unstable:0 
  slab_reclaimable:2196 slab_unreclaimable:2525 
  mapped:93 shmem:3984 pagetables:643 bounce:0 
  free:2722 free_pcp:120 free_cma:0 
 [251815.851058] Node 0 active_anon:479840kB inactive_anon:479980kB active_file:352kB inactive_file:448kB unevictable:0kB isolated(anon):0kB isolated(file):0kB mapped:372kB dirty:0kB writeback:0kB shmem:15936kB writeback_tmp:0kB unstable:0kB all_unreclaimable? yes 
 [251815.851077] Normal free:10736kB min:3480kB low:4348kB high:5216kB active_anon:365272kB inactive_anon:348536kB active_file:24kB inactive_file:328kB unevictable:0kB writepending:0kB present:786432kB managed:763080kB mlocked:0kB slab_reclaimable:8784kB slab_unreclaimable:10100kB kernel_stack:1144kB pagetables:1408kB bounce:0kB free_pcp:368kB local_pcp:72kB free_cma:0kB 
 [251815.851078] lowmem_reserve[]: 0 1907 1907 
 [251815.851100] HighMem free:152kB min:236kB low:516kB high:796kB active_anon:114568kB inactive_anon:131444kB active_file:116kB inactive_file:104kB unevictable:0kB writepending:0kB present:260520kB managed:260520kB mlocked:0kB slab_reclaimable:0kB slab_unreclaimable:0kB kernel_stack:0kB pagetables:1164kB bounce:0kB free_pcp:112kB local_pcp:56kB free_cma:0kB 
 [251815.851102] lowmem_reserve[]: 0 0 0 
 [251815.851112] Normal: 211*4kB (UME) 127*8kB (UME) 109*16kB (UME) 46*32kB (UME) 39*64kB (UME) 13*128kB (ME) 8*256kB (ME) 0*512kB 0*1024kB 0*2048kB 0*4096kB = 11284kB 
 [251815.851154] HighMem: 1*4kB (C) 11*8kB (M) 4*16kB (M) 0*32kB 0*64kB 0*128kB 0*256kB 0*512kB 0*1024kB 0*2048kB 0*4096kB = 156kB 
 [251815.851188] 4236 total pagecache pages 
 [251815.851193] 0 pages in swap cache 
 [251815.851197] Swap cache stats: add 0, delete 0, find 0/0 
 [251815.851200] Free swap    = 131068kB 
 [251815.851203] Total swap = 131068kB 
 [251815.851205] 261738 pages RAM 
 [251815.851208] 65130 pages HighMem/MovableOnly 
 [251815.851211] 5838 pages reserved 
 [251815.851213] 4096 pages cma reserved 
 [251815.851217] [ pid ]     uid    tgid total_vm        rss nr_ptes nr_pmds swapents oom_score_adj name 
 [251815.851246] [    271]       0     271       2684        127         8         0          0           -1000 systemd-udevd 
 [251815.851254] [    440]       0     440       1845        107         6         0          0               0 systemd-journal 
 [251815.851261] [    584]       0     584       1798        770         8         0          0               0 haveged 
 [251815.851269] [    585]       0     585       1114         58         7         0          0               0 cron 
 [251815.851276] [    586]       0     586      13393        334        17         0          0               0 NetworkManager 
 [251815.851284] [    588]       0     588       7850        156        13         0          0               0 rsyslogd 
 [251815.851292] [    590]       0     590        774         62         6         0          0               0 systemd-logind 
 [251815.851300] [    593]     104     593       1217        134         6         0          0            -900 dbus-daemon 
 [251815.851307] [    647]     105     647       1185        106         7         0          0               0 ntpd 
 [251815.851315] [    649]     108     649     261471     232065       515         0          0               0 tvheadend 
 [251815.851323] [    650]       0     650        780         41         5         0          0               0 lircd 
 [251815.851331] [    715]       0     715       8976        163        12         0          0               0 polkitd 
 [251815.851339] [    720]       0     720        844         30         5         0          0               0 agetty 
 [251815.851347] [    728]       0     728        889         30         6         0          0               0 agetty 
 [251815.851354] [    811]       0     811       1944       1174         8         0          0               0 dhclient 
 [251815.851363] [ 1257]       0    1257       1635        115         8         0          0           -1000 sshd 
 </pre> ``` 

 Is this a memory leak or is it related to the xbox tuner?

Back